Multipurpose clamping and fixing device for building construction
Technical Field
The invention relates to the technical field of constructional engineering, in particular to a multipurpose clamping and fixing device for building construction.
Background
The building engineering is a part of construction engineering, and refers to an engineering entity formed by the construction of various house buildings and their auxiliary facilities and the installation activities of lines, pipelines and equipment matched with the house buildings, including factory buildings, theaters, hotels, shops, schools, hospitals, houses and the like, and meets the requirements of people on production, living, study, public activities and the like.
The existing clamping and fixing device clamps the template through a movable clamping plate, but the clamping force of the end part is insufficient due to the lack of support at the top end of the clamping plate, so that the clamping effect is influenced.
Disclosure of Invention
The invention aims to solve the defects that the clamping force of the end part is insufficient due to lack of support at the top end of a clamping plate in the prior art, and the like, and provides a multipurpose clamping and fixing device for building construction.
In order to achieve the purpose, the invention adopts the following technical scheme:
the multipurpose clamping and fixing device for building construction comprises a clamping frame, wherein two groups of sliding seats are symmetrically and slidably connected to the opening at the top of the clamping frame, a clamping plate is rotationally connected to the end part of each sliding seat in a pin joint mode, a supporting structure of a fixing clamping plate is arranged at the top of each sliding seat, an L-shaped rod is arranged at the bottom of each sliding seat, teeth are arranged on the end faces of the two opposite ends of the L-shaped rods, a gear is rotationally connected to the middle of the clamping frame, the top and the bottom of the gear are respectively in meshing transmission with the teeth on the end faces of the two groups of L-shaped rods, a fixing pipe is fixedly connected to the end part of the gear, a square hole is formed in one end, away from the gear, of the fixing pipe, a square pipe is movably inserted in the square hole, a first spring is fixedly connected between the inner wall of the square pipe and the inner wall of the square hole, and, and a fixing device for limiting the rotation of the rotating shaft is arranged on the outer side of the rotating shaft.
Preferably, the supporting structure comprises two groups of connecting rods in pin joint, the ends of the two groups of connecting rods departing from each other are in pin joint with the top of the sliding seat and the back end of the clamping plate respectively, a limiting hole is formed in the end of one group of connecting rods, and a spring button clamped in the limiting hole is arranged at the end of the other group of connecting rods.
Preferably, the top of the sliding seat is provided with a placing groove for placing the connecting rod.
Preferably, the fixing device comprises a ratchet wheel fixedly arranged on the rotating shaft, a pawl clamped with the ratchet wheel is rotatably connected to the end face of the clamping frame through a pin shaft, and a torsion spring is fixedly connected between the pawl and the pin shaft inside the pawl.
Preferably, a second spring is fixedly connected between the two groups of L-shaped rods.
Preferably, a plurality of groups of anti-skidding teeth are vertically arranged on the opposite end surfaces of the two groups of clamping plates at intervals.
Preferably, both sides of the opening of the clamping frame are fixedly provided with guide rails, and the sliding seat is connected with the guide rails in a sliding manner through a sliding block.
Preferably, the back end of the clamping plate and the corresponding position of the top of the sliding seat are respectively provided with a magnet, and the magnets of the two groups are opposite in magnetism.
The multipurpose clamping and fixing device for building construction provided by the invention has the beneficial effects that: the connecting rod arranged at the top of the sliding seat is used for supporting and fixing the top end of the clamping plate, so that the problem of insufficient clamping force of the end part caused by lack of support at the top end of the clamping plate in the prior art is solved, the connecting rod is of a foldable structure, the clamping plate can be conveniently folded and stored, the placing space is saved, the carrying is convenient, the arranged anti-skidding teeth can enhance the occlusion force and the friction force between the clamping plate and the mold, the clamping plate and the mold can be better fixed, and the fixing device is reasonable in design, simple to operate and high in practicability.

In the figure: 1. a clamping frame; 2. a sliding seat; 3. a splint; 301. anti-slip teeth; 4. a support structure; 401. a connecting rod; 402. a placement groove; 403. a limiting hole; 404. a spring button; 5. an L-shaped rod; 6. a gear; 7. a fixed tube; 8. a square hole; 9. a square tube; 10. a first spring; 11. a rotating shaft; 12. a fixing device; 1201. a ratchet wheel; 1202. a pawl; 1203. a torsion spring; 13. a second spring.
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
Referring to fig. 1-4, a multipurpose clamping and fixing device for building construction comprises a clamping frame 1, wherein the opening at the top of the clamping frame 1 is symmetrically and slidably connected with two sets of sliding seats 2, the end parts of the sliding seats 2 are in pin joint with and rotate with clamping plates 3, the top of the sliding seat 2 is provided with a supporting structure 4 for fixing the clamping plates 3, the bottom of the sliding seat 2 is provided with an L-shaped rod 5, the end surfaces of the opposite ends of the two L-shaped rods 5 are respectively provided with teeth, the middle part of the clamping frame 1 is rotatably connected with a gear 6, the top and the bottom of the gear 6 are respectively in meshing transmission with the teeth on the end surfaces of the two sets of L-shaped rods 5, the end part of the gear 6 is fixedly connected with a fixing pipe 7, one end of the fixing pipe 7, which is far away from the gear 6, is provided with a square hole 8, a square pipe 9 is movably inserted inside the square hole 8, a first spring 10 is fixedly connected between the inner, the outer side of the rotating shaft 11 is provided with a fixing device 12 for limiting the rotation of the rotating shaft 11.
The supporting structure 4 comprises two groups of connecting rods 401 connected with each other through pins, one ends of the two groups of connecting rods 401 departing from each other are respectively connected with the top of the sliding seat 2 and the back end of the clamping plate 3 through pins, a limiting hole 403 is formed in the end of one group of connecting rods 401, and a spring button 404 clamped in the limiting hole 403 is arranged at the end of the other group of connecting rods 401.
The top of sliding seat 2 is seted up the standing groove 402 of placing connecting rod 401, and the standing groove 402 of setting is convenient for accomodating connecting rod 401 to reduce the clearance between splint 3 and sliding seat 2.
The fixing device 12 includes a ratchet 1201 fixedly disposed on the rotating shaft 11, a pawl 1202 rotatably connected to an end surface of the holding frame 1 through a pin and engaged with the ratchet 1201, and a torsion spring 1203 fixedly connected between the pawl 1202 and an inner pin thereof.
Fixedly connected with second spring 13 between two sets of L type poles 5, the second spring 13 through setting up is convenient for when loosening this fixing device, and two sets of splint 3 can break away from the mould fast to convenient to use person dismantles.
Equal vertical and interval is provided with multiunit antiskid tooth 301 on the relative terminal surface of two sets of splint 3, and the antiskid tooth 301 of setting can strengthen occlusal force and frictional force between splint 3 and the mould for can be fixed better between splint 3 and the mould.
The guide rails are fixedly arranged on two sides of the opening of the clamping frame 1, and the sliding seat 2 is connected with the guide rails in a sliding mode through the sliding blocks.
All be provided with the magnetite on splint 3's the relevant position at back end and sliding seat 2 top, two sets of magnetite magnetism is opposite, and the magnetite of setting is convenient for adsorb splint 3 and sliding seat 2 fixedly when folding connecting rod 401.
A working mode; the during operation, establish the both sides at the mould with 3 covers of two sets of splint, the user can rotate pivot 11, pivot 11 drives gear 6 and rotates, thereby make two sets of L type pole 5 produce relative motion, L type pole 5 drives sliding seat 2 and removes, thereby it is fixed to drive splint 3 and carry out the centre gripping to the mould, when not needing to use, the user can stimulate pivot 11, pivot 11 drives the inside removal of bright 8 in side of square pipe 9, and the separation of ratchet 1201 and pawl in the pivot 11, the magnetite can the direction rotate pivot 11 and make two sets of splint 3 and template separation, press the spring button 404 of connecting rod 401 bottom, make its inside from spacing hole 403 break away from, the user can be with the inside of connecting rod 401 folding at standing groove 402, and adsorb fixedly with splint 3 and sliding seat 2 through the magnetite, thereby occupation space portable does not.
